Output e6ec2ca3dc00748540fe9d3c03e2bb7e258480ef5a599b137e03345fd917c0f0:2

value
51776999405
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 311364a5e4c98cef5dbd56aa9549f4ffaa13caea OP_EQUALVERIFY OP_CHECKSIG
address
LPhSc5BFPQMqBwk7AccF14vT3BLgAY43Cy
transaction
e6ec2ca3dc00748540fe9d3c03e2bb7e258480ef5a599b137e03345fd917c0f0
spent
true